Output c8c7231bb66a6bbaf7d90ef929cb8fc91e66d1a138b633bfa8ee19eab5aa7f03:1

value
1267692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f68c91bf57f6b5e52b155de8f8591c82cc4257a OP_EQUALVERIFY OP_CHECKSIG
address
19hUirXGe68yKGTUatNxzJRhXBTEZUGLiu
transaction
c8c7231bb66a6bbaf7d90ef929cb8fc91e66d1a138b633bfa8ee19eab5aa7f03
spent
true